Hyundai Tucson: Warnings and indicators / Low tire pressure indicator

The low tire pressure indicator comes on for 3 seconds after the ignition switch is turned to the "ON" position.

The low tire pressure indicator illuminates when one or more of your tires is significantly underinflated.

The low tire pressure indicator will illuminate after it blinks for approximately one minute when there is a problem with the Tire Pressure Monitoring System.

If this occurs, have the system checked by an authorized HYUNDAI dealer as soon as possible.
